Mzuzu City has a female Deputy Mayor

Councillor Monica Simwaka for Malawi Congress Party (MCP) has become the first Deputy Mayor for Mzuzu since the constitution of Malawi allowed the council to have Mayor and Deputy Mayor in 1970.

Simwaka is the Councillor for Katawa Ward and has won 10 votes from the 16 votes cast.

Her competitors were MCP Councillor for Mzilawaingwe Ward, Tonny Mwenitete, who received three votes and Hiwett Mkandawire, Councillor for UTM for Chiputula ward, who got three votes.

Member of Parliament for Mzuzu City, Bennex Mwamlima, said the combination of the two is a sign of a strong Tonse Alliance.
